How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Union County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Union County Studio Apartments | $1,947 | $1,100 | $6,700 |
| Union County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,477 | $1,000 | $5,869 |
| Union County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,348 | $1,209 | $8,275 |
| Union County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,635 | $1,397 | $9,095 |
| Union County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,925 | $1,897 | $5,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Union County
How much are Studio apartments in Union County?
There are currently 902 Studio Apartments in Union County with rent ranges from $1,100 to $6,700 with an average price of $1,947.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Union County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Union County ranges from $1,000 to $5,869 with an average monthly rent of $2,477.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Union County c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Union County range from $1,209 to $8,275.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,348.
How expensive are Union County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 211 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Union County on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,397 to $9,095 - averaging $3,635 for the location.
